simon lehericey
|
42f0b87c39
|
remove api_up?
|
2024-04-05 12:27:54 +02:00 |
|
Colin Darie
|
e23e2d9c31
|
perf(export): download in chunks files >= 10 mb
|
2024-04-02 15:54:46 +02:00 |
|
Colin Darie
|
d161589e2f
|
fix(api-entreprise): Context is not defined in jobs
|
2024-03-26 12:45:28 +01:00 |
|
simon lehericey
|
2ea6a5d25c
|
remove now useless biz_dev module
|
2024-03-21 11:54:03 +01:00 |
|
Christophe Robillard
|
05a7198442
|
remove useless spec
|
2024-03-06 21:18:09 +01:00 |
|
Paul Chavard
|
f3a97876bd
|
fix(champ): champs are not ordered anymore
|
2024-03-04 10:59:11 +01:00 |
|
Paul Chavard
|
2eb1f54aa1
|
refactor(dossier_loader): ignore champs from old revisions
|
2024-03-04 10:59:11 +01:00 |
|
Paul Chavard
|
20307f1d21
|
refactor(address): use directly BAN data
|
2024-02-16 12:15:14 +01:00 |
|
Martin
|
32e8f34511
|
refactor(PiecesJustificativesService): stop passing flags, pass user_profile and manage ACL from the service itself
|
2024-02-16 11:23:39 +01:00 |
|
Lisa Durand
|
f09ab62620
|
add rna type de champ to harmonize api with rnf
|
2024-02-12 17:20:07 +01:00 |
|
Martin
|
2952987ad8
|
refactor(spec): stop using procedure type de champs traits as :with_datetime , :with_xxx in favor of :types_de_champ_public which keeps position in check
|
2024-01-23 17:30:22 +01:00 |
|
Martin
|
aecc41490b
|
tech(refactor): deplace le mail rate limiter dans le module dédié à l'expiration
|
2023-11-17 11:33:14 +01:00 |
|
Martin
|
fb238ff7ac
|
tech(refactor): deplace l'echelonnement des taches cron liés a l'expiration dans un module dédié
|
2023-11-17 11:33:14 +01:00 |
|
Christophe Robillard
|
a2f5687aa3
|
migrate api entreprise privileges
|
2023-11-15 17:19:53 +01:00 |
|
Colin Darie
|
65feaa37e3
|
test: fix deprecated Mail::CheckDeliveryParams.check syntax
|
2023-11-10 14:19:57 +01:00 |
|
Colin Darie
|
edb47d94f7
|
test: fix not_to raise_error(SpecificErrorClass) false positive risk
|
2023-11-09 17:27:55 +01:00 |
|
mfo
|
87c3615774
|
review(tech): utilise un code unique pr les elements de l'autocomplete, corrections de typos, amelioration du code
Co-authored-by: LeSim <mail@simon.lehericey.net>
|
2023-11-09 11:10:17 +01:00 |
|
Eric Leroy-Terquem
|
694cbcd0a2
|
feat(rnf): add rnf type_de_champ
|
2023-11-07 14:21:28 +01:00 |
|
Christophe Robillard
|
42d3052c4f
|
convert code_insee to departement
|
2023-10-26 11:34:55 +02:00 |
|
krichtof
|
7ae66d0360
|
Merge pull request #9613 from demarches-simplifiees/8742-effectifs
tech: utilise l'api entreprise v3 pour récupérer les effectifs mensuels et annuels
|
2023-10-19 14:46:10 +00:00 |
|
mfo
|
8a4299ade1
|
Merge pull request #9610 from mfo/US/fix-missing-champs
correctif(data): tâche rake recréant les champs manquant à un dossier ayant subi une perte de données
|
2023-10-19 09:49:35 +00:00 |
|
Martin
|
70c54808fa
|
amelioration(datafixer.DossierChampsMissing): prends aussi en compte les champs manquant dans une repetition
|
2023-10-19 11:25:10 +02:00 |
|
Christophe Robillard
|
0f1e243b01
|
use api entreprise v3 for effectifs annuels
|
2023-10-17 13:48:46 +02:00 |
|
Christophe Robillard
|
81f78c62b4
|
use api entreprise v3 for effectifs mensuels
|
2023-10-17 13:48:46 +02:00 |
|
Martin
|
95bdcc986e
|
refactor(renomme): deplace le phone_fixer.rb dans un repertoire dedié aux fix de data en prod
|
2023-10-16 17:25:06 +02:00 |
|
Martin
|
8069c5bb7c
|
correctif(data): ajoute une classe pour ajouter les champs manquant a des dossiers qui ont subit une perte de donnée supposant qu'une race-condition sur le dossier.merge(fork) puisse detruire des champs
|
2023-10-16 17:18:10 +02:00 |
|
Kara Diaby
|
a26df43577
|
User : Ajoute le type de champ Expression régulière coté utilisateur
|
2023-10-16 08:53:52 +00:00 |
|
Eric Leroy-Terquem
|
1ecd05df54
|
task(phone): add task to fix invalid phones
|
2023-10-12 17:57:43 +02:00 |
|
Eric Leroy-Terquem
|
a960395edb
|
fix(db): add phone fixer
|
2023-10-12 16:47:05 +02:00 |
|
Christophe Robillard
|
75d671c0b4
|
fix: email no siret service
|
2023-10-06 11:16:12 +02:00 |
|
Christophe Robillard
|
20d70d2b1c
|
notify admin with service without siret
|
2023-09-29 11:37:34 +02:00 |
|
simon lehericey
|
5534190c89
|
chore: build openstack client without calling now private service.client
|
2023-09-07 15:57:39 +02:00 |
|
Paul Chavard
|
ca4066939c
|
chore(pipedrive): remove pipedrive
|
2023-08-10 10:29:25 +02:00 |
|
Christophe Robillard
|
af8b423e4c
|
fix siren spec
|
2023-07-31 10:56:05 +02:00 |
|
Christophe Robillard
|
2963fdbfa3
|
send dinum siret when siret service same as siret etablissement requested
|
2023-07-26 19:27:08 +02:00 |
|
Christophe Robillard
|
619dfd5553
|
send service siret as recipient
|
2023-07-19 10:08:44 +02:00 |
|
Paul Chavard
|
d5820277c0
|
feat(cojo): add cojo type de champ
|
2023-07-10 14:57:34 +02:00 |
|
Martin
|
a0ceee96bd
|
amelioration(email.resume_hebdomadaire): envoie le mail a 4h du matin sur une periode de 3h
tech(
Co-authored-by: Colin Darie <colin@darie.eu>
|
2023-06-26 17:47:53 +02:00 |
|
Martin
|
d45a250075
|
amelioration(mail): ajoute d'un simili rate limiter pour envoyer les mails sur des fenetres de temps ayant une limite
|
2023-06-26 17:28:27 +02:00 |
|
Martin
|
50da50a7ac
|
amelioration(bilan_bdf.resultat_exercice): implement la logique d'affichage du resultat d'un exercice sur l'API v3
|
2023-06-01 15:04:09 +02:00 |
|
Christophe Robillard
|
0f083db32b
|
migrate bilans bdf adapter to v3
|
2023-06-01 14:03:31 +02:00 |
|
mfo
|
c2f2b4ef2a
|
Merge pull request #9106 from mfo/api-entreprise.etablissement_adapter
API Entreprise: migration "Etablissement"
|
2023-06-01 11:45:47 +00:00 |
|
mfo
|
1a6dc10548
|
Merge pull request #9102 from demarches-simplifiees/8472-migrate-rna
API Entreprise: migration RNA (associations)
|
2023-06-01 11:37:57 +00:00 |
|
Martin
|
c90175f121
|
tech(api-entreprise.etablissement): passage du endpoint ETABLISSEMENT_RESOURCE_NAME en v3
|
2023-06-01 09:06:36 +02:00 |
|
Martin
|
0d3deb01be
|
tech(rna_controller#show): corrige les specs et recupère uniquement les informations utilisé par l'app
|
2023-05-31 16:11:12 +02:00 |
|
Eric Leroy-Terquem
|
2db2625fc8
|
Merge pull request #8923 from demarches-simplifiees/migrate-data-for-routing-with-dropdown-list
Migre les données pour le nouveau mode de routage
|
2023-05-31 08:42:11 +00:00 |
|
Christophe Robillard
|
ef82149a3b
|
amelioration(api-entreprise.rna): passe a la v3 pour le endpoint RNA_RESOURCE_NAME
|
2023-05-31 09:59:44 +02:00 |
|
Colin Darie
|
3161f90662
|
Merge pull request #9098 from demarches-simplifiees/8472-migrer-attestation-fiscale
API Entreprise : migration "attestation fiscale"
|
2023-05-30 08:52:17 +00:00 |
|
Christophe Robillard
|
0e85f84eff
|
migrate exercices adapter
|
2023-05-29 17:46:39 +02:00 |
|
Christophe Robillard
|
0ec4c3d17b
|
migrate attestation fiscale adapter to v4
|
2023-05-29 15:22:07 +02:00 |
|
krichtof
|
0051face93
|
Merge pull request #9014 from demarches-simplifiees/8859-default_zones
Etq admin, lors de la création ou modification d'une démarche, des zones par défaut me sont suggérées
|
2023-05-26 17:25:21 +00:00 |
|
Christophe Robillard
|
76a8b721ce
|
add tva adapter and tva job
|
2023-05-26 13:37:20 +02:00 |
|
Christophe Robillard
|
f04e121a6f
|
add extrait_kbis to handle nom_commercial and capital_social
|
2023-05-26 13:37:20 +02:00 |
|
Christophe Robillard
|
ba281d53cf
|
migrate entreprise adapter to v3
|
2023-05-26 13:37:20 +02:00 |
|
krichtof
|
601fde2147
|
Merge pull request #9084 from demarches-simplifiees/8472-migration-attestation-sociale
8472 migration attestation sociale
|
2023-05-25 07:11:59 +00:00 |
|
Paul Chavard
|
e191cfb3f6
|
task(revision): find and correct all champs with wrong type de champ
|
2023-05-24 16:34:46 +02:00 |
|
Christophe Robillard
|
247ad49ab7
|
migrate attestation_sociale to v4
|
2023-05-24 11:52:43 +02:00 |
|
Paul Chavard
|
2ec0d405f7
|
chore(recovery): import/export revision
|
2023-05-19 11:19:15 +02:00 |
|
Martin
|
32088512ff
|
amelioration(importer): evite de re-importer un dossier pointant vers un parent qui est maintenant detruit
|
2023-05-16 17:00:34 +02:00 |
|
Martin
|
f76e52cc97
|
tech(tache.recovery): ajoute une tache pour re-importer des dossiers venant d'un backup
Update app/lib/recovery/exporter.rb
Co-authored-by: Colin Darie <colin@darie.eu>
|
2023-05-16 14:49:36 +02:00 |
|
simon lehericey
|
9d1d523cf6
|
remove life_cycle
|
2023-05-16 14:49:36 +02:00 |
|
simon lehericey
|
06b6663662
|
import more stuff
|
2023-05-16 14:49:36 +02:00 |
|
Martin
|
e9115b10b5
|
correctif(data.kc): re-import les données kc
|
2023-05-16 14:49:36 +02:00 |
|
Christophe Robillard
|
53dd2955e4
|
add tchap hs adapter
|
2023-05-16 09:40:53 +02:00 |
|
Paul Chavard
|
c40f42db19
|
fix(dossier): task to fix cloned published revisions
|
2023-05-12 16:52:59 +02:00 |
|
simon lehericey
|
a5d4773d31
|
feat(routing): task to backfill procedure.defaut_groupe_instructeur_id
|
2023-05-12 10:10:27 +02:00 |
|
Colin Darie
|
5be8865675
|
fix(export): sanitize filename containing unsafe chars for storage
Pourrait fixer des problèmes de dezip sous windows de zip.
|
2023-05-04 14:36:44 +02:00 |
|
Colin Darie
|
f615facbba
|
fix(export): don't fail when trying to write a file name > 255 bytes
|
2023-05-04 14:36:33 +02:00 |
|
Paul Chavard
|
46f9148fa4
|
Merge pull request #8984 from tchak/fix-api-entreprise-status
ETQ usager, je veux être avertie si l'API entreprise est HS
|
2023-04-28 14:25:02 +00:00 |
|
simon lehericey
|
47bae606f1
|
spec: remove weird now obsolete spec which pollute global namespace with logic helper
and make spread_architect tests fail
|
2023-04-28 10:42:09 +02:00 |
|
Paul Chavard
|
99abdf45e7
|
fix(api-entreprise): use new status endpoint
|
2023-04-27 22:39:44 +02:00 |
|
simon lehericey
|
86e0538425
|
keep test active_storage service
|
2023-04-26 22:46:16 +02:00 |
|
simon lehericey
|
f1bcb84832
|
fix: replace ds_eq operator by ds_include when targeted_champ is a multiple_drop_down_list
|
2023-04-26 09:37:03 +02:00 |
|
simon lehericey
|
c189115757
|
fix defaut_groupe_instructeur for mismatching label
|
2023-04-24 10:16:09 +02:00 |
|
simon lehericey
|
995858e124
|
fix defaut_groupe_instructeur_id for (hidden) procedure with an (hidden) parent
|
2023-04-24 10:16:09 +02:00 |
|
simon lehericey
|
439447b343
|
fix defaut_groupe_instructeur_id and change dossier.groupe_instructeur_id
|
2023-04-21 15:08:07 +02:00 |
|
Colin Darie
|
b273e7b67e
|
chore(rubocop): fix Rails/RootPathnameMethods and assimiled cops
|
2023-04-19 12:55:13 +02:00 |
|
LeSim
|
c252748833
|
Merge pull request #8836 from demarches-simplifiees/improve-routing-rules-ux
feat(routing): nicer and safer ?
|
2023-04-17 08:23:15 +00:00 |
|
Paul Chavard
|
5abb6a8f12
|
chore(spec): remove memory store cache from tests
|
2023-04-13 13:10:23 +02:00 |
|
simon lehericey
|
a5200a569f
|
feat(routing): task to backfill procedure.defaut_groupe_instructeur_id
|
2023-04-13 10:44:06 +02:00 |
|
sebastiencarceles
|
d7bfb9dc18
|
enrich value from education api
|
2023-02-28 14:23:38 +01:00 |
|
Damien Le Thiec
|
731cd56594
|
Merge branch 'main' into feature/prefill_repetible
|
2023-02-22 19:49:06 +01:00 |
|
sebastiencarceles
|
b85eeedd6c
|
remove departements and regions migration specs
|
2023-02-20 09:01:04 +01:00 |
|
Damien Le Thiec
|
2533ca50d4
|
Merge branch 'main' into feature/prefill_repetible
|
2023-02-15 11:07:56 +01:00 |
|
sebastiencarceles
|
f0ffae8320
|
migrate(champs): normalize departements
|
2023-02-13 16:32:34 +01:00 |
|
Damien Le Thiec
|
dbb92e7fd3
|
Merge branch 'main' into feature/prefill_repetible
|
2023-02-11 22:40:56 +01:00 |
|
sebastiencarceles
|
d2f5fe5ff5
|
migrate(champs): normalize regions
|
2023-02-09 10:46:17 +01:00 |
|
Damien Le Thiec
|
a51ed0094b
|
Fix tests
|
2023-02-07 00:28:21 +01:00 |
|
Martin
|
14494255be
|
Revert "migrate(champs): normalize departements (#8505)"
This reverts commit 6800bb8cec .
|
2023-02-06 15:57:26 +01:00 |
|
Martin
|
db36397bc5
|
Revert "migration: normalize regions (#8521)"
This reverts commit 8fee658eba .
|
2023-02-06 14:49:51 +01:00 |
|
Colin Darie
|
b0b7114c3b
|
feat: jsv support for primitives
|
2023-02-02 14:55:46 +01:00 |
|
Sébastien Carceles
|
8fee658eba
|
migration: normalize regions (#8521)
|
2023-02-02 10:19:33 +00:00 |
|
Sébastien Carceles
|
6800bb8cec
|
migrate(champs): normalize departements (#8505)
* migration: normalize departements
* rename update_all methods to avoid collusions
* simplify scopes
|
2023-02-02 10:00:56 +00:00 |
|
Damien Le Thiec
|
d7b01255fe
|
Merge branch 'main' into feature/prefill_repetible
|
2023-01-31 16:39:00 +01:00 |
|
Colin Darie
|
ef864021f7
|
refactor(pj_service): explicit options with_{bills,champs_private} because expert & instructeurs does not need the same
|
2023-01-30 18:04:09 +01:00 |
|
Sébastien Carceles
|
49ce255e29
|
feat(dossier): prefill region champ (#8442)
* make regions champ prefillable
* add possible and example value
* add external_id and value validation
|
2023-01-24 11:25:17 +00:00 |
|
Paul Chavard
|
a4cbbe721e
|
feat(types de champ): add EPCI champ
|
2023-01-20 11:32:36 +01:00 |
|
Martin
|
733ba01695
|
amelioration(balancer_delivery_method): implemente le fait de forcer la methode de delivery au niveau de notre balancer de fournisseur demail
|
2023-01-11 17:13:05 +01:00 |
|
Lisa Durand
|
8ba13cb685
|
humanize raison sociale from api_entreprise in adapter
|
2023-01-11 14:42:38 +01:00 |
|
Colin Darie
|
820cb4bd27
|
fix(rna): some associations don't have date_publication
https://sentry.io/organizations/demarches-simplifiees/issues/3698792231/events/fde901fac5a44129adcafc891d59d086/?project=1429550
|
2023-01-11 12:30:02 +01:00 |
|